Responsibilities:

Coordinate all aspects of assigned clinical trials from site initiation to study close‑out

Conduct subject visits and ensure timely, accurate documentation following ALCOA‑C standards

Maintain compliance with study protocols, GCP/ICH guidelines, FDA regulations, IRB policies, and company SOPs

Manage subject recruitment, informed consent, and retention strategies

Ensure timely data entry and resolution of EDC queries

Report and follow up on all adverse events, serious adverse events, and deviations

Collaborate with investigators, lab teams, sponsors/CROs, and internal stakeholders

Prepare for and participate in monitoring visits, audits, and inspections

Maintain regulatory documentation and ensure proper training is completed for all study amendments and systems

Execute study procedures such as phlebotomy, ECGs, and sample processing within scope (as trained)

Attend investigator meetings and provide cross‑functional support as needed

Maintain working knowledge of study protocols, laboratory manuals, equipment calibration, and inventory control
